Concrete Foundation Repair in North Bergen, NJ
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the structural stability of a building’s base. These services typically involve assessing and fixing probl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ting in the foundation ca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or aging materials. Projects can include fixing cracks in basement walls, leveling uneven slabs, or stabilizing foundations to prevent further damage. Homeowners often seek this service to protect their property value, ensure safety, and avoid costly repairs in the future.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the signs of foundation issues, such as visible cracks, doors or windows that stick, or uneven flooring. It’s also helpful to know the extent of the problem and whether it affects the entire structure or specific areas. Proper evaluation and diagnosis are essential to determine the most appropriate repair methods, which can vary depending on the severity and cause of the foundation issues.

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of foundation problems? Cracks in walls or floors, uneven floors, and sticking doors or windows may indicate foundation issues.
How does concrete foundation repair improve property stability? Repairing the foundation helps prevent further damage, ensures safety, and maintains the property's value.
What types of foundation repairs are typically performed? Common repairs include underpinning, slabjacking, crack sealing, and piering to stabilize and restore the foundation.
When should property owners consider foundation repair? Repairs are advisable when signs of shifting, cracking, or settling are observed to avoid more extensive damage.
